Navi Mumbai: NMMC Demolishes Unauthorised Structures in Ghansoli

The Navi Mumbai Municipal Corporation (NMMC) conducted an anti-encroachment drive in Ghansoli, targeting unauthorized constructions that exceeded approved permissions. Despite receiving multiple notices from NMMC’s Encroachment Department, the property owners failed to comply.

As a result, under the directives of Commissioner Dr. Kailas Shinde and the guidance of Additional Commissioner (2) Dr. Rahul Gethe and Deputy Commissioner (Encroachment) Mr. Bhagwat Doifode, the department took eviction action in the Ghansoli division.

In the jurisdiction of NMMC’s Ghansoli ward, property owners Sushant Subhash Thorat (Plot No. 277-278), Sushilkumar Radheshyam Barnwal (Plot No. 280-281), Jitendra Kumar Bindeshwari Prasad (Plot No. 282-283), and Amar Chalke (Plot No. 284-285) had initially obtained Occupancy Certificates from NMMC. However, they later constructed additional RCC columns and extended their row houses' front and rear sections, exceeding the approved building plan.

The operation deployed one JCB machine, five workers, and one pickup van to demolish these unauthorized extensions. The action was overseen by Ghansoli Division Assistant Officer Sanjay Tayde, Junior Engineer Rohit Thakre, personnel from the Encroachment Department, and a police team to ensure a smooth execution.

NMMC has reaffirmed its commitment to curbing unauthorized constructions and will intensify similar anti-encroachment actions moving forward.
